Transaction 89a648311e4f7081367f2c9abb19bb0fe0a36492398e8e8e3b496c46b455b081

1 Input
2 Outputs
  • 89a648311e4f7081367f2c9abb19bb0fe0a36492398e8e8e3b496c46b455b081:0
  • value  470764734
    address  19aC2zAB2ykXyqM7o2bDKdN7b2MDcqdyaK
  • 89a648311e4f7081367f2c9abb19bb0fe0a36492398e8e8e3b496c46b455b081:1
  • value  17876654
    address  1Hzpkfsk6gqpXfrjZXH9sH5VFMDwu29MTW